				Sony Librie first inofficial English firmware patch
			  Earlier this week we reported  that some Linux folks were working on a firmware hack to "englishfy" the user interface of the Sony Librie e-book reader. The first firmware patch is now available and at least one Librie owner could tell me that he was successful in applying the hack. Only a few japanese letters, the USB and powersaving message boxes have not been translated yet. Make sure to read the HOWTO carefully! Screwing up a flash update could easily render your device useless (in that case don't throw it away, but send it to me - I have a thing for broken devices).
